Welcome to The Social Impact Podcast, where we explore stories of individuals and organizations making a difference in the world. In this episode, join us as we sit down with Christine Ross, the founder and Executive Director of Aid Another.

Christine's journey began with a personal need: the desire to provide her sons, both diagnosed with Autism, with the same enriching experiences as her older son. Out of this necessity, Aid Another was born, a nonprofit organization dedicated to offering adaptive athletics, arts, and a sense of community for individuals with disabilities.

In this candid conversation, Christine shares the challenges and triumphs of creating a nonprofit from the ground up, emphasizing the importance of inclusion and celebration in every aspect of their work. From overcoming obstacles to fostering a culture of belonging, Christine's story is one of resilience, compassion, and unwavering dedication to social change.
